'Avengers' Tom Hiddleston Talks the Return of Loki (Video)
It was a thrill for fans to hear that Loki, Thor’s (Chris Hemsworth) power hungry adopted brother, and the actor who played him in Thor, Tom Hiddleston, would be reprising his role for the upcoming The Avengers movie despite what seemed like his demise.
Heat Vision breakdown
“What happens in the space between the end of Thor and the beginning of The Avengers is Loki’s made some very shady deals with the gangsters on the streets of the Nine Realms,” Hiddleston tells The Hollywood Reporter at Saturday’s D23 Expo.
“At the beginning of Avengers, he comes to earth to subjugate it,” he continues. “And his idea is to rule the human race as their king. And like all the delusional autocrats of human history, he thinks this is a great idea because if everyone is busy worshipping him, there will be no wars.”

And when we asked him who he based his portrayal of the villain on, he answered, “I guess there’s a lot of people in the world who feel they don’t belong anywhere and what happens after that is you have to manage that feeling.”
